Needle Galaxy

English

Etymology

By surface analysis, needle +‎ galaxy, named for its flat shape and rotation relative to Earth only allowing for a side profile of the galaxy to the naked eye. Proper noun

the Needle Galaxy

  1. a spiral galaxy, NGC designation NGC 4565, in the Coma Berenices.
